The Importance of Replacing Your Air Conditioner

An air conditioner is a significant investment in your home’s comfort, and when it’s no longer functioning efficiently, it can affect both your comfort and your finances. Here’s why replacing air conditioner could be the best decision for you:

1. Enhanced Efficiency

As air conditioners age, they gradually lose efficiency. An older system may struggle to cool your home, causing it to consume more energy and driving up utility bills. By upgrading to a more energy-efficient model, you can enjoy better cooling with lower energy consumption, saving money in the long run.

2. Improved Air Quality

An older AC unit may not effectively filter the air, causing dust, mold, and other pollutants to build up within the system. A newer AC can enhance indoor air quality by removing allergens and other harmful particles from the air, creating a healthier living environment. This is particularly beneficial for those with respiratory conditions or allergies.

3. Better Comfort

Old air conditioners can struggle to maintain a consistent temperature throughout your home, leading to uneven cooling in different rooms. Newer models provide more consistent and efficient cooling, ensuring your entire home stays comfortable, whether you choose a central air conditioning system or a ductless mini-split system.

4. Fewer Repairs

As air conditioners age, they become more prone to breakdowns and repairs. If your AC unit is frequently malfunctioning, replacing it can save you the hassle of constant repairs and help you avoid costly maintenance bills. A new unit offers greater reliability and peace of mind.

What to Consider When Replacing Your Air Conditioner

Replacing your air conditioner involves several factors. Before making the switch, here’s what to keep in mind:

1. Proper Sizing

It’s crucial to choose the right size air conditioning unit for your space. An oversized system can cause inefficiencies, while an undersized one may struggle to cool your home. A professional technician can help determine the right size based on your home’s square footage and other relevant factors.

2. Energy Efficiency

One of the primary reasons to replace an old air conditioner is to benefit from improved energy efficiency. Look for units with a high SEER (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io) rating, as these systems consume less energy while delivering better cooling performance. This will help reduce your environmental impact and lower your monthly utility bills.

3. Types of Systems

There are various types of air conditioners to choose from, depending on your home’s needs. Some common options include:

  • Central Air Conditioning: Ideal for cooling larger homes or spaces with multiple rooms, this system uses ducts to distribute cool air throughout the house.

  • Ductless Mini-Split Systems: Perfect for homes without existing ductwork or specific rooms that need extra cooling. These systems offer customizable temperature control for different zones.

  • Heat Pumps: Versatile systems that provide both heating and cooling, heat pumps are energy-efficient and ideal for homes with variable climates.

4. Installation Process

When replacing your air conditioner, the installation process is just as important as choosing the right unit. Professional installation ensures your new system is set up correctly and efficiently. Certified technicians handle the installation process, making sure everything is done properly to ensure long-lasting performance.

5. Maintenance Needs

While a new air conditioner will require less maintenance than an older model, it’s still important to keep up with regular servicing. Annual maintenance, such as cleaning filters and checking refrigerant levels, will help ensure your system continues to operate efficiently for years to come.
